Did You Know?
Most Popular Hike
The most popular hike in Zion is called The Narrows, where hikers wade through the Virgin River as it carves its way through the canyon.
Hanging Gardens
Zion is known for its 'hanging gardens,' where water seeping from the sandstone cliffs supports unique plant communities, most notably seen around the Emerald Pools.
Challenging Hike
Angels Landing is a famous, but strenuous, hike in Zion National Park that involves steep switchbacks and chains bolted into the rock for safety.
Primary Water Source
The Virgin River is the primary water source that carved Zion Canyon over millions of years.
